So, I joined a swap over at MSR last month (no surprise... hehehehe...)! It was hosted by the lovely Stephanie and was called "Brown Paper Embellishment Packages Tied Up with String." Sounds cute, huh? This swap was basically wrapping up 6 small embellishment goodies in brown wrapping paper and tying it with string! The wrapper could also be further embellished if we wished to do so. 
 
Well, for this swap, we had an odd number of participants and so we did a "round the house robin" kind of thing.  This means that one person will be sending me a box of goodies and I send my box to a completely different person.  I got in touch with the lady who I'm sending goodies to, and was able to procure a very good sized wish list! Also, in addition to her wish list, I found out the her favorite color is purple, which gave me the color of ribbon I wanted to tie my packages with!
